Applications of EDTA:
EDTA is an important complexing agent. EDTA is widely used as a bleaching fixer for color photographic materials processing, dyeing auxiliaries, fiber processing auxiliaries, cosmetic additives, blood anticoagulants, detergents, stabilizers, synthetic rubber polymerization initiators, EDTA is a chelate. A representative substance of the mixture. It can form stable water-soluble complexes with alkali metals, rare earth elements and transition metals.
